Risks

Score: 2.8 (Weak)

Net debt to EBITDA of 12.5x and interest coverage below 1.0x leave ALTG far more exposed to refinancing and covenant pressure than most transport peers with stronger balance sheets.

A quick ratio of 0.51x and current ratio of 1.38x indicate limited near-term liquidity, increasing vulnerability to working-capital swings versus better-capitalized peers.

A 143-day cash conversion cycle, driven by 124 days of inventory, ties up cash longer than asset-light peers and can constrain growth investment if demand softens.

High leverage combined with weak coverage makes ALTG more sensitive to freight-rate or utilization downturns than peers with lower fixed-charge burdens and more flexible cost structures.

Opportunities

Score:

If freight demand and pricing remain firm, ALTG’s leveraged operating model can translate incremental volume into faster earnings recovery than less levered peers.

Inventory-heavy working capital creates room for cash release if operations normalize, which could improve liquidity faster than peers already running leaner cycles.

Any easing in interest rates would disproportionately benefit ALTG versus peers with similar debt loads, because sub-1.0x coverage leaves financing costs a larger earnings drag.

A stronger operating backdrop could help ALTG narrow the valuation gap to healthier peers, but only if leverage and liquidity metrics improve materially.
